Exporting can be a complex process, especially for B2B suppliers looking to enter new markets. Fortunately, there are several tools and resources that can streamline exporting processes and enhance global trade. This article explores essential tools that every B2B supplier should consider.
Efficient export documentation is critical to ensure compliance with international regulations. Export documentation software can help suppliers automate the creation of necessary documents, reducing errors and saving time. These tools often include templates for invoices, packing lists, and customs declarations.
Managing logistics is a significant challenge in international trade. Logistics management platforms allow B2B suppliers to track shipments, manage inventory, and coordinate with freight forwarders. These platforms facilitate better communication and transparency throughout the supply chain.
Understanding target markets is essential for successful exporting. Market research tools provide valuable insights into consumer behavior, market trends, and competitive landscapes. By utilizing these resources, B2B suppliers can make informed decisions about their export strategies.
Compliance with international trade regulations is essential to avoid penalties and delays. Access to trade compliance resources can help B2B suppliers stay updated on relevant laws, tariffs, and trade agreements. These resources often include databases, regulatory guides, and consulting services.
Exporting does not have to be a daunting task for B2B suppliers. By utilizing essential tools such as export documentation software, logistics management platforms, market research tools, and trade compliance resources, suppliers can streamline their exporting processes and enhance their global trade efforts.
